paper51.com 目 录 http://www.paper51.com 一、引言. 1 copyright paper51.com 1.1问题描述... 1 内容来自论文无忧网 www.paper51.com 1.2研究思路... 1 paper51.com 二、课程网络学习平台的特点和功能. 1 内容来自www.paper51.com 2.1特点... 1 内容来自www.paper51.com 2.2 功能... 1 内容来自论文无忧网 www.paper51.com 三、可行性研究. 3 http://www.paper51.com
3.1技术可行性... 3 内容来自www.paper51.com 3.2经济可行性... 3 copyright paper51.com 3.3操作可行性... 3 内容来自www.paper51.com 3.4法律可行性... 3 内容来自www.paper51.com
四、学生作业模块的设计. 4 http://www.paper51.com 4.1 学生作业模块的功能... 4 paper51.com 4.2 数据库的设计与实现... 4 内容来自论文无忧网 www.paper51.com 4.3技术难点... 8 内容来自www.paper51.com
五、 系统测试. 8 内容来自论文无忧网 www.paper51.com 5.1. 测试的任务及目标... 8 内容来自论文无忧网 www.paper51.com
5.2测试方案... 9 copyright paper51.com 5.3测试结论... 12 内容来自论文无忧网 www.paper51.com 六、总结. 12 http://www.paper51.com 参考文献. 12 http://www.paper51.com 致 谢. 13 http://www.paper51.com 内容来自www.paper51.com 一、引言 内容来自www.paper51.com
近年来,以互联网为核心的信息技术对人类社会的发展、进步和繁荣起着越来越重要的作用。互联网已经渗透到社会生活的各个方面,成为推动社会进步的重要力量。 paper51.com 网络技术发展到现在,Web数据库技术已经成为应用最为广泛的系统架构基础技术.在互联网的应用系统中,Web提供了通信联络的有效手段,利用Web技术,实现Web服务器与数据库系统的连接,完成对数据的处理与查询,用户通过操作简单易学的浏览器浏览下载所需要的各种数据。 http://www.paper51.com 1.1问题描述 http://www.paper51.com 为了弥补课堂学习之不足,为学生提供多途径的学习环境,我们拟借助网络平台,构建《数据结构》课程的学习平台,充分利用网络技术,将课程资源上网,给学生提供一个自主学习的平台,满足不同层次学生的学习需求,使《数据结构》从课堂教学逐步转向课堂与网络教学并行的新教学模式。与传统教学模式相比,学生学习不受时间、地点的限制,学习内容自主选择,在线答疑模块的设计便于师生之间的交流,教师能及时发现学生的问题并加以指导,学生可以通过自我检测及时掌握自己学习情况,同时可以网上上交作业,为课程教学顺利进行提供有力的帮助。 copyright paper51.com
1.2研究思路 http://www.paper51.com 本系统的开发环境是windows XP ,采用JSP技术,数据库采用SQL SERVER 2000设计;按照软件开发的流程进行系统开发。JSP是SUM公司提供的一种动态网页实现技术,而SQL则是Microsoft公司数据库系列中的旗舰产品,两者的结合,为Web数据库技术提供了完美的实现体系。 内容来自www.paper51.com 二、课程网络学习平台的特点和功能 copyright paper51.com 2.1特点 copyright paper51.com
网络教学是一种以学生为主的教学模式,强调学生的自主性和创造力的培养,强调学生以资源为基础学习,《数据结构》课程网络学习平台集中了各种学习资源,打破传统的教学模式,打破单一的教师授课的教学方式,实现教学资源的共享和教学方式的多样化。 http://www.paper51.com 2.2 功能 paper51.com
本学习平台按照数据结构教学大纲的要求,将本课程的所有资源上网,为学生提供了学习、练习、作业、实践、自我检测等完整的学习环节,可以充分调动学生学习的主动性、积极性, 提高学生的学习兴趣, 为学生今后编程的学习打下坚实的基础。在线答疑功能实现了师生间的及时交流,在线自我检测功能实现了学生对自身学习情况的检测;作业功能实现了作业的实时管理。 内容来自www.paper51.com 系统的功能结构图为: 内容来自www.paper51.com
内容来自www.paper51.com 内容来自论文无忧网 www.paper51.com 图2-2-1 数据结构学习平台功能结构图 http://www.paper51.com http://www.paper51.com
内容来自www.paper51.com
copyright paper51.com 图2-2-2 数据结构学习平台后台 内容来自论文无忧网 www.paper51.com 内容来自www.paper51.com 三、可行性研究 内容来自www.paper51.com 可行性研究的目的是用最小的代价,在尽可能短时间内确定问题是否能够解决,它的目的不是解决问题,而是确定问题是否值得去解决,可行性从以下四个方面来考虑: 内容来自www.paper51.com 3.1技术可行性 内容来自论文无忧网 www.paper51.com 《数据结构》课程网络学习平台是由网络和网页实现的。本系统使用SUM公司的JSP技术,选择应用界面友好且功能强大的由Macromedia公司的Macromedia Dreamweaver MX软件来设计界面,服务器端脚本用JAVA来编写,数据库使用SQL SERVER 2000 数据库,服务器是TOMCAT 6.0.28。本人在学校学过这几门语言,并且进行过多次课程实习,对系统开发有一定的了解,再加指导老师的指导,所以在技术上是可行的。 内容来自www.paper51.com 3.2经济可行性 内容来自www.paper51.com 本模块的经济投入主要集中在计算机硬件设备上,由于计算机硬件设备价格低廉,利用现有的设备即可完成本模块的正常运行。与其它的模块相比,本模块独立性相当强,只需要投入较少的资金即可。而它的成功运行将节省大量的人力物力,为学生获得学生作业信息提供了便利的条件,从而提高工作效率,本模块的运行,利用基本的计算机配置即可,因此在经济上可行的。 copyright paper51.com 3.3操作可行性 内容来自论文无忧网 www.paper51.com 随着计算机技术和互联网的不断发展,软硬件条件都已经达到了运行系统的条件。系统的开发人员也已经具备独立开发的能力。同时,本系统能保证在当前的操作环境下正常运行,系统管理人员对系统的更新维护具备足够的管理能力。而且具有完善的后台管理功能,管理者(教师)可以直接在后台进行文件、信息的上传,方便了管理。所以,本系统直观易懂,使用非常方便,只要经过简单的培训,操作本系统没有太大的问题。 paper51.com 3.4法律可行性 copyright paper51.com 本系统开发不会侵犯他人、集体或国家利益,不存在侵权等问题,不违反国家法律,因此具有法律可行性[1]。 http://www.paper51.com |